Programa Em Python Para Calcular Desconto De 5% Em Produtos
E aí, pessoal! Tudo bem com vocês? Hoje, vamos falar sobre um programa super útil que calcula o desconto de 5% em um produto e mostra o valor final com o desconto aplicado. Se você está começando a programar ou só quer uma solução rápida para essa tarefa, este artigo é para você! Vamos mergulhar no mundo da programação e criar algo prático e funcional.
Imagine a seguinte situação: você está em uma loja e quer saber quanto vai pagar por um produto que tem 5% de desconto. Para fazer essa conta manualmente, você precisa pegar o valor do produto, calcular 5% desse valor e subtrair do valor original. Parece simples, mas e se você pudesse ter um programa que fizesse isso automaticamente? Bem mais fácil, né?
Nosso objetivo é criar um programa que receba o nome e o valor de um produto, calcule o desconto de 5% e mostre o valor final já com o desconto aplicado. Esse tipo de programa pode ser usado em diversas situações, como em lojas virtuais, sistemas de controle de estoque ou até mesmo para uso pessoal. Vamos mostrar como a programação pode facilitar o nosso dia a dia e tornar tarefas repetitivas em algo simples e rápido.
Para criar nosso programa, vamos seguir alguns passos simples e claros. Assim, você poderá entender cada etapa do processo e até mesmo adaptar o código para outras situações. Vamos lá:
1. Receber o Nome e o Valor do Produto
A primeira coisa que nosso programa precisa fazer é receber o nome e o valor do produto. Para isso, vamos usar funções de entrada de dados, que permitem ao usuário digitar essas informações. No Python, por exemplo, podemos usar a função input()
para receber o nome e o valor do produto.
Para receber o nome, podemos usar o seguinte código:
nome_produto = input("Digite o nome do produto: ")
E para receber o valor, podemos usar o seguinte código:
valor_produto = float(input("Digite o valor do produto: "))
Note que usamos float()
para converter o valor digitado em um número decimal, já que o valor do produto pode ter casas decimais.
2. Calcular o Desconto de 5%
Agora que temos o valor do produto, precisamos calcular o desconto de 5%. Para isso, podemos multiplicar o valor do produto por 0.05 (que representa 5%) e guardar esse resultado em uma variável. O código ficaria assim:
desconto = valor_produto * 0.05
Essa é a parte matemática do nosso programa. Simples, né? A beleza da programação está em transformar problemas complexos em pequenas operações como essa.
3. Calcular o Valor Final com Desconto
Com o valor do desconto calculado, o próximo passo é subtrair esse valor do valor original do produto. Assim, teremos o valor final com o desconto aplicado. O código para isso é:
valor_final = valor_produto - desconto
Agora temos o valor que o cliente realmente vai pagar pelo produto. Estamos quase lá!
4. Mostrar o Nome do Produto e o Valor Final
Finalmente, precisamos mostrar o resultado para o usuário. Para isso, podemos usar funções de saída de dados, que exibem informações na tela. No Python, a função print()
é perfeita para isso. Podemos usar o seguinte código:
print("Produto:", nome_produto)
print("Valor final com desconto: R{{content}}quot;, valor_final)
Esse código mostrará o nome do produto e o valor final com o desconto aplicado, tudo formatado de forma clara e amigável. Mostrar os resultados de forma organizada é fundamental para que o usuário entenda as informações.
Agora que vimos cada passo do processo, vamos juntar tudo em um código completo. Assim, você pode copiar e colar o código no seu ambiente de programação e testar o programa. Aqui está o código completo em Python:
nome_produto = input("Digite o nome do produto: ")
valor_produto = float(input("Digite o valor do produto: "))
desconto = valor_produto * 0.05
valor_final = valor_produto - desconto
print("Produto:", nome_produto)
print("Valor final com desconto: R{{content}}quot;, valor_final)
Simples, né? Com poucas linhas de código, criamos um programa que calcula o desconto de 5% em um produto e mostra o valor final. A programação é uma ferramenta poderosa que nos permite automatizar tarefas e resolver problemas de forma eficiente.
Para testar o programa, basta executar o código e digitar o nome e o valor do produto quando solicitado. Por exemplo, se você digitar "Camiseta" como nome do produto e "50" como valor, o programa calculará o desconto de 5% (que é R$ 2,50) e mostrará o valor final de R$ 47,50.
Experimente digitar diferentes nomes e valores para ver o programa funcionando. Você pode até mesmo modificar o código para calcular descontos diferentes, como 10% ou 20%. A prática leva à perfeição, então quanto mais você testar e experimentar, mais você aprenderá.
Nosso programa já faz o que propusemos, mas sempre podemos melhorar, né? Aqui estão algumas ideias de melhorias e próximos passos:
- Validar a entrada de dados: Podemos adicionar código para verificar se o valor digitado é realmente um número. Assim, evitamos erros caso o usuário digite algo errado.
- Calcular descontos diferentes: Podemos modificar o programa para que ele peça a porcentagem de desconto ao usuário, em vez de ser fixo em 5%. Isso tornaria o programa mais flexível.
- Criar uma interface gráfica: Em vez de usar o terminal, podemos criar uma interface gráfica com botões e caixas de texto para o usuário interagir com o programa de forma mais intuitiva.
- Adicionar mais funcionalidades: Podemos adicionar funcionalidades como calcular o valor total de vários produtos, aplicar diferentes tipos de desconto (por exemplo, desconto fixo em reais) e até mesmo integrar o programa com um banco de dados para armazenar informações sobre os produtos.
As possibilidades são infinitas! A programação é uma jornada de aprendizado constante, e sempre há algo novo para descobrir e implementar.
Criamos um programa simples, mas poderoso, que calcula o desconto de 5% em um produto e mostra o valor final. Vimos como receber dados do usuário, realizar cálculos matemáticos e mostrar resultados na tela. E o mais importante: vimos como a programação pode facilitar o nosso dia a dia.
Espero que este artigo tenha sido útil e que você tenha aprendido algo novo. Se você está começando a programar, continue praticando e explorando novas ideias. A programação é uma habilidade valiosa que pode abrir muitas portas e te ajudar a resolver problemas de forma criativa e eficiente.
Se tiver alguma dúvida ou sugestão, deixe um comentário abaixo. E não se esqueça de compartilhar este artigo com seus amigos que também estão aprendendo a programar. Até a próxima!
- Programa para calcular desconto
- Desconto de 5% em produto
- Calcular valor final com desconto
- Python
- Programação para iniciantes
- Automatizar cálculos
- Entrada e saída de dados
- Interface gráfica
- Validação de dados
- Próximos passos em programação